It’s called a Value Pack for good reason – a large quantity of quality ammunition for an affordable price. Loaded with 36-grain copper-plated hollow-point bullets, it delivers muzzle velocities up to 1,260 fps. The bullet expands rapidly on impact, making it ideal for small-game hunting. Value-conscious, high-volume shooters will appreciate the performance this ammunition delivers. Per 525.
